In the Superhero universe, Batman is one of the most well known and one of the most badass character ever created. This character was created by two friends Bob Kane and Bill Finger. Bob was the artist whereas Bill was writer of Batman comic series. This character first appeared in ‘Detective Comics #27’ in the year 1939. Batman is Gay

During the 1950s Batman was referred as a ’Gay’ by pubic. This was because of his habit of adopting and spending his time with teenage boys like Robin, which led some people to state that Batman is gay. It became more viral after Dr. Fredric Werthem’s book ‘Seduction of the Innocent’. This book was also further responsible for the creation of the ‘Comics Code Authority’

Gotham Jewellers

We have encountered with many iconic imaginary cities in DC comics like Metropolis, Amazon, Atlantis, etc. But the most popular DC city will always be ‘Gotham’. But when this city was first named, it was not based on any mythology or epic but instead it landed its name by the writer randomly picking a name from the telephone directory named ‘Gotham Jewellers’.

Mash up of Famous names

The name ‘Bruce Wayne’ was given by writer Bill Finger, which actually was adopted from two great leaders. One being Scottish national hero Robert the Bruce and the other was American revolutionary “Mad” Anthony Wayne.

Batman’s Utility Belt

Batman’s whole outfit consists of a special component without which Batman will lose his 50% power, his Utility belt. Batman’s utility belt has ten compartments which he fills with various tools depending on type of opponent. Among the items Batman carries in his belt are batarangs, knock-out gas, tiny cameras, hooks, spybots and yes, Kryptonite.

Hate for Keaton

When Michael Keaton was selected for the role of Batman, there was a lot of hate among the public regarding this decision. This was because Keaton was a comedy actor at that time and fans predicted that he may ruin Batman’s character. But for everyone’s surprise, the movie became a massive hit, earning $100 million in its first 10 days at the box office.

Batplane came first

The Batplane which Batman uses was actually introduced earlier than the Batmobile. The Batplane was introduced in the ‘Detective comics #31’ whereas the unauthorised Batmobile was introduced as a red sedan in ‘Detective comics #48’.

Extraordinary Bat-suit

We all know that Batman doesn’t have any huge super power, Right? But his suit is not ordinary. The suit is fire-resistant, insulated from electric shock and bulletproof. His cape can act as a parachute or a hang-glider. His cowl contains a lot of high-tech tools like communication systems, built in mini oxygen tank and night vision, and is lined with lead to keep certain super-powered individuals from seeing his true identity. Batman meets Superman

After just one year of Batman’s debut in the ‘Detective comics’, it became a super hit. So the writers Jerry Robinson and Dick Sprang decided to portray the two cornerstones of their industry (Superman and Batman) together in one comic issue. Hence, we got to see the alliance of Batman and Superman for the first time in ‘World’s Finest Comics’ (Originally named as World’s Best Comics) released in fall 1940.
